Transaction 20a23d0650b62bb82e672091803ccac72478e727c3d892c339cdbd39aded8131

1 Input
1 Outputs
  • 20a23d0650b62bb82e672091803ccac72478e727c3d892c339cdbd39aded8131:0
  • value  8791584
    address  1bFdzyf1U9cCu96mtc25daADKZzG92gXW